Press Release – SANTA CLARA, CA – NVIDIA today announced an alliance with Ubisoft to offer PC gamers the best gaming experiences possible for Ubisoft’s biggest fall titles, including Tom Clancy’s™ Splinter Cell® Blacklist™, Assassins Creed® IV Black Flag and Watch Dogs™.

Well unlike Michael Dell trying to buy back his company that is named after himself, Activision has bought itself back from the parent holding company Vivendi.
